Programa do Curso

Introdução

  • Descrição geral do Microsoft SQL Server 2019
  • Funcionalidades e ferramentas do SQL Server 2019
  • Compreensão dos conceitos fundamentais do SQL Server 2019

Começar a trabalhar

  • Instalar o SQL Servidor
  • Instalar o Management studio
  • Ativar funcionalidades utilizando o gestor de configuração
  • Utilizar o Management Studio
  • Autenticar e conceder permissões de utilizador
  • Criar uma nova conta de utilizador

Criação de Databases

  • Criar a primeira base de dados
  • Configurar a base de dados
  • Compreender as estruturas das tabelas
  • Criar uma tabela simples
  • Editar uma tabela
  • Introduzir dados
  • Importar dados de ficheiros csv
  • Criar tabelas a partir de ficheiros simples
  • Instalar uma base de dados de amostra

Manter um ambiente saudável Database

  • Compreender os tipos de dados
  • Compreender as propriedades das colunas da tabela
  • Utilizar campos de chave primária
  • Estabelecer valores por defeito
  • Restrições de verificação e exclusivas
  • Utilizar chaves estrangeiras
  • Criar uma coluna de chave externa
  • Criação de relações entre tabelas

Utilização da linguagem de consulta estruturada

  • Compreender o papel do T-SQL
  • Utilizar o editor T-SQL
  • Criar uma tabela com o T-SQL
  • Adicionar dados a uma tabela
  • Recuperar registos
  • Filtrar os resultados obtidos
  • Ordenar e atualizar registos
  • Eliminar registos de uma tabela
  • Juntar tabelas relacionadas
  • Remoção de uma tabela da base de dados

Desempenho e programabilidade da consulta

  • Criar uma vista dos dados
  • Utilizar índices de tabelas de dados
  • Criar índices adicionais numa tabela
  • Visualizar planos de execução
  • SQL Armazenamento de consultas do servidor
  • Reconstrução de índices
  • Funções de agregação
  • Utilizar funções incorporadas
  • Funções escalares definidas pelo utilizador
  • Criando procedimentos armazenados
  • Utilização de procedimentos armazenados parametrizados

Cópia de segurança e restauro

  • Criar uma cópia de segurança completa da base de dados
  • Criar uma cópia de segurança diferencial
  • Restaurar uma cópia de segurança
  • Automatização de cópias de segurança
  • Utilizar soluções de continuidade da atividade

Segurança

  • Compreender as funções e permissões dos utilizadores
  • Utilizar esquemas de bases de dados
  • Mascaramento dinâmico de dados
  • Encriptação de dados Always On

Management e Monitorização

  • Explorar o papel das bases de dados do sistema
  • Prevenindo o crescimento automático excessivo do tempdb
  • Analisar o SQL Registo de erros do servidor
  • Utilizar vistas de gestão dinâmicas
  • Comandos da consola de bases de dados (DBCC)

Resumo e próximas etapas

Requisitos

  • Conhecimentos básicos de SQL

Público

  • Database administradores
 14 horas

Declaração de Clientes (5)

Próximas Formações Provisórias